Walk of Hope to Benefit ALS will be held in September

WAKEFIELD — The 23rd annual Walk of Hope for ALS, a 3.5-mile walk around Lake Quannapowitt in Wakefield to benefit The Angel Fund for ALS research, will be held on Saturday, September 7. The walk begins with registration at 9 a.m. followed by the start of the walk at 11 a.m. The release of doves…

SC taps Geary as superintendent

By DAN TOMASELLO

LYNNFIELD — The School Committee voted 4-1 to appoint Tom Geary as permanent superintendent of schools, subject to successful contract negotiations, during a contentious July 10 meeting.

Geary, who had been serving as interim superintendent since February, began working for the district in July 2006 as the School Department’s finance director. His…
